About Yugo Kanai
Yugo Kanai is a scholar working on Nephrology,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ism and Rheumatology, having authored 21 papers that have together received 444 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Heart Failure Treatment and Management (4 papers), GDF15 and Related Biomarkers (3 papers) and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ism (106 citations), Oncology (125 citations) and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(77 citations). Yugo Kanai has collaborated with scholars based in Japan and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Akihiro Yasoda, Nobuya Inagaki, Toshihito Fujii, Yohei Ueda, Keisho Hirota, Ichiro Yamauchi, Eri Kondo, Yui Yamashita, Masakatsu Sone and Daisuke Taura.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Clinical Investigation, PLoS ONE and Circulation Research.
